Printing calculators are advanced calculators that are designed to print out calculations as they are being performed. These calculators are ideal for businesses and individuals who need to keep a record of their calculations. They are especially useful for those who work in accounting, finance, and other fields where accuracy is essential. With their advanced features such as tax calculation, currency conversion, and cost-sell-margin functions, printing calculators are a great investment for anyone who needs to perform complex calculations quickly and efficiently.

Sharp ELT3301 Thermal Printing Calculator with Large Display
The Sharp ELT3301 Calculator is designed for easy reading and efficiency. Its extra-large backlit LCD ensures that you can clearly see your calculations, even in low light. You can switch between a standard 12-digit printout and a larger 10-digit option, making it ideal for various needs. Changing paper is hassle-free with the accessible top-loading compartment, eliminating the frustration of narrow slots. With super fast and quiet thermal printing at 8.0 lines per second, you can quickly produce your calculations without the mess of ink. This calculator truly enhances your productivity.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Are printing calculators still used?
In an age of computer spreadsheets and desktop calculators, one might wonder why the need for printing calculators still exists. However, a great number of financial institutions, accountants, and tax professionals still use these machines daily.
2. What is the printing calculator?
Printing calculators are larger versions of standard pocket calculators and are used for financial calculations. What makes them different from other calculators is that they have a printing contraption attached, which can be used for billing purposes.
3. Why do accountants use printing calculators?
Financial calculators typically have hundreds of functions built in for tax calculations as well as profit/loss computations. These machines are suitable for accountants who plan to use the devices daily. Printing calculators have built-in printers so bookkeepers can keep a physical copy of slips on hand.
